I received my PhD (Physics) in 1999 and went directly to industry. At that time I saw industry as a well paid post doc. My intention was to work a few years and then seek an academic position. In 2001 I had an offer from a top engineering school in Canada to join their faculty. And I said no. And also wrong. My wife left academia from philosophy and is pulling in north of 100k right now doing project management stuff. She got there within 3 years, though we're in NYC so it's easier to get more cash here. It was a hard to transition, most employers don't know what to do with a humanities degree, but she was able to do it. A programmer coworker of mine also worked in philosophy, and transitioned to programming and is doing rather well for himself. He did this over the past few years, so long after computer science was well established. Transitioning out of humanities academia into non-academic jobs is difficult, much harder than for those in the sciences, but it's quite doable

> 100 passengers have queued up to board a plane, and are lined up in the order of the seats on the plane (n=1..100). However, the first person lost his ticket and selects a random seat. The remaining passengers will occupy their assigned seat if it is available, or a random seat otherwise. What is the probability that passenger 100 sits in seat 100? It really worried me that I couldn't figure out how to work that ou…

I have no idea if that is correct, but my initial intuition was that it would be a high percentage like you found. However, now that I'm thinking about it, I believe the answer is closer to 50%.

When passenger 100 begins to board, there are only two possible configurations he can find the seats in: seat 1 available or seat 100 available. If Passenger 1 sits in seat 100, then passengers 2-99 will sit in their correct seats, leaving only seat 1. If passenger 1 sits in seat 1, passengers 2-99 will sit correctly and leave only seat 100 for passenger 100. If passenger 1 sits anywhere else (say, seat 50), passengers 2 - 49 will fill correctly, passenger 50 will have to sit in seat 1 or 51-100. The moment a passenger randomly selects seat 1 or 100, the remaining passengers will sit correctly (except for passenger 100). It is impossible for any seats other than 1 or 100 to be left for passenger 100 to select.

From looking at it, I don't believe there is any bias for the end configuration to leave seat 100 open more than seat 1, and I believe that in an interview situation, you would be expected to intuit this by "talking it out". If I'm right (and I could still be very wrong), this is more of a probabilistic brainteaser than a programming interview question.

Jeeeeesus christ, that grep is ugly.

  grep "[0-9]\{3\}[-]\?[0-9]\{3\}[-]\?[0-9]\{4\}" filename.txt
The default behavior of grep appears to be to not treat {}?() as special characters. Which is generally boneheaded in my experience, and certainly in this case. An irritated man will use egrep--short for grep -E, "extended regexes"--i.e. sane regexes:

  egrep "[0-9]{3}-?[0-9]{3}-?[0-9]{4}" filename.txt
This is just a direct translation. If I wrote the regex myself, I would probably also recognize spaces as delimiters (as in "999 999 9999"), and maybe note that the area code might be missing or have parens around it, etc.--depending on just what I was trying to parse. I dunno, maybe he's parsing regular machine output and his original regex would suffice, so I won't go farther than an equivalent translation. But I will, for kicks, mention this:

  egrep "([0-9]{3}-?){2}[0-9]{4}" filename.txt
(Note that - is not a special character in either grep or egrep, although command-line programs in general treat specially any argument beginning with -, so it is a good idea to use [-] instead of - if that happens to be the first character of your string. But after that, no.)

Also, for general purposes, grep -P (Perl regexes) is best of all, because it can do *? non-greedy matching. A really irritated man has aliased pgrep to "grep -P --color=auto" in his bash startup file, and has also (perhaps dangerously) aliased grep to it as well. (That breaks fewer things than altering GREP_OPTIONS.)
